Stoked about a Powell-Peralta Documentary. Imagine walking into a cafe and seeing all these guys sitting together? Also Mike V. is back riding for Powell-Peralta. I must say that is way better than Element.    Stacy, Rodney, CAB, Tony, Mike, Lance and Tommy will be working on a Bones Brigade Documentary starting in February 2011.
